Documents Required to Apply for NBFC License in India

An NBFC License is the authorization to establish a Non banking Financial Company and providing the following services:

  1. Lending loans
  2. Receiving deposits
  3. Investment
  4. Infrastructure Financing
  5. Micro Financing
  6. And services within the same vein.

To obtain the license, the aspirant has to reach out to the Reserve Bank of India along with the requisite documents. This article explains the documents required to apply for NBFC License in India.

Document Checklist for the NBFC License

The applicant has to submit a duly filled application form along with the following documents to the regional office of the Reserve Bank of India (RBI):

Management Information

A document detailing the information of the management including the names and address details of the management personnel has to be provided to the RBI.

Copies of Company Incorporation Certificate and Certificate of Commencement

If the applicant is a Public Limited Company, he has to submit Certificate of commencement in addition to the certificate of incorporation of the company.

Copies of the MOA and AOA: The aspirant must submit certified copies of the Memorandum of Association and Articles of Association. Additionally, the applicant must provide a separate document containing the financial business related clauses mentioned in the Memorandum of Association.

PAN Card of the company: It’s a document that proves the tax-paying status of the applicant entity.

Financial Statements: The applicant must present the financial statements of the last 2 years up to the date of filing the application of NBFC license.

Board resolution (Approval): The applicant must have the board’s approval to file the application for NBFC license. Thus, it’s mandatory submit a certified copy of the board resolution stating that approval.

Board resolution (deposit): Board resolution declaring that the applicant company hasn’t engage with any NBFC activity prior to obtaining the NBFC license.

Board Resolution (Fair Practice Code): Board resolution declaring that the applicant company agrees to adhere with the Fair Practice Code associated with the NBFC activities.

Statutory auditor certificates

The applicant must submit the following two NBFC certificates:

One stating that the applicant company hasn’t engaged with any NBFC activity prior to obtaining the license.

And another stating the net owned fund of the applicant company.

Copy of the fixed Deposit Receipt & Bankers certificate: Copy of the fixed deposit receipt and the banker’s certificate showing that the applicant meets the net worth requirement for the NBFC license.

Authorized share capital and the paid capital of the company. Furthermore, information about shareholding pattern in percentages should also be provided to the RBI.

  • Bank balance sheet
  • Audited balance sheet of the last three years must also be provided to the RBI.
  • Business plan of the company for the next three years. It must show the details of the:
  • Trajectory of business
  • Market segment
  • Projected balance sheets
  • Cash Flow statement
  • Asset income pattern statement
  • Source of the startup capital of the company
  • Self-attested bank statement and income tax returns etc.
